Academics

Saint Anne School offers an educational experience in four and three year preschool, full and half-day kindergarten, and first through eighth grade. The total enrollment for the 2006-2007 school year was 240 students. There is a low pupil/teacher ratio of only 16 students to 1 teacher. The average class size is 20 students. Saint Anne School offers a full academic curriculum, daily religious education and sacramental preparation, computer classes, Spanish, music, art, and physical education. There is even some additional services that are available to assist students at this school. Those additional services include remedial math and reading programs, testing, counseling, speech therapy, morning and after-school extended care programs. Located within the school is the school's library which holds 5,500+ volumes, supplemented with videos and audio tapes. There is also a brand new networked computer lab and classrooms, internet access, two laser printers (one color), digital cameras and projection unit.

Extracurricular activities

The activities offered at Saint Anne School are PA Junior Academy of Science, Student Newspaper, Forensics, English Festival, Stump the Students, Lectors, Altar Servers, Spelling Bee, and Band & Advanced Band.

The sporting activities that students have the ability to join are Cross-Country, Track, Cheerleading, Diocesan Football, and Basketball (Varsity, Junior Varsity, and Instructional).
